Open Wings

Is it not silly and sensational?

We board the skyboat,
finding seats and storage spaces,
and passages to places away and back,

our lives held in open wings
and massive motors,
lifted aloft by laws of physics
that defy our bodies…

and we are carried off
against the rhythm of the sun,
wreaking havoc on day and night
in order to serve the dreams and desires
or fulfill the duties and deals
in which we have invested our hearts.

We turn our lives around
in a world we barely know
trusting precision and effort
in the crafting of this craft
to bring our wingless form  
back to ground...
